Impatiens subfalcata (balsaminaceae), A new species from Laos

Impatiens subfalcata Soulad. & Tagane, a new species of Balsaminaceae from southern Laos, is described and illustrated. The new species is morphologically similar to Impatiens attopeuensis and I. notoptera in having succulent stems, serrate leaf margins and pinkish flowers, but distinguished from these two by its falcate lanceolate or oblanceolate leaves, more numer ous secondary veins, shor ter petioles and smaller dorsal petals.
